The weakest structural and economic position in the world system is known as the periphery. Peripheral nations are those on the fringes of the global economy, dominated by core nations, with very little industrialization. These nations primarily provide raw materials and agricultural products, have higher instances of occupations like farming and mining, and generally earn less income with fewer chances for promotion. There is also a prevalent issue of brain drain in these regions, where educated or skilled individuals migrate to urban areas or other countries for better opportunities and seldom return. This contributes to the continuous weakness of the peripheral nations' position in the world system.

In contrast, semi-peripheral nations occupy an intermediate position, neither powerful enough to dictate global policy nor as economically marginalized as peripheral nations. These countries often serve as a major source of raw materials and provide an expanding marketplace for the middle class of core countries. The core nations are highly industrialized, technologically advanced, and urbanized, dominating global economies and often exploiting both semi-peripheral and peripheral nations through economic legislation and trade agreements such as NAFTA.
